Prime Minister of Nepal, Sher Bahadur Deuba has reposed faith in Make in India initiative saying, it will also help Nepal in reviving its manufacturing sector and create jobs. 

Speaking at a India-Nepal Business Forum meeting in New Delhi yesterday, Mr Deuba said, through Foreign Direct Investment, Nepal is eager to participate in the scaling up benefit from the regional value chain. The Nepalese Premier said his goal is to work for the future youth. 

Mr Deuba said, his talks with Mr Modi will emphasise on a forward looking development agenda that is defined by collaboration on projects that can inspire both societies and transform their economies in 21st



century. 

Mr Deuba said, with the rise of India and China as global economic powers, Nepal can be the new melting pot for tourists, traders and investors.Speaking at the India-Nepal Business Forum, Petroleum Minister Dharmendra Pradhan said, the foundation stone for oil product pipeline will be laid by October this year. He said, India intends to take further the natural gas pipeline from Gorakhpur to Sonwal in Nepal. 

He also said that Indian Oil Corporation and Nepal Oil are in talks for setting up 100 petrol pumps in the neighbouring country so that employment can be generated for 2,500 Nepalese youth. He also stressed on Gas connections for Nepalese women.
